Work wirelessly
Using Bluetoothยฎ technology, your iMac can wirelessly connect (that is, pair) with devices such as the included Magic Mouse 2 and Magic Keyboard, and with optional devices like the Magic Trackpad 2, the Magic Keyboard with Numeric Keypad, peripheral devices, wearable sport accessories, and others.
Some included accessories may already be paired with your iMac. For more information about accessories, see the next section, Whatโs included.
Connect a Bluetooth device. Turn on the device so that itโs discoverable, then open System Preferences and click Bluetooth. Select the device in the list, then click Connect. The device remains connected until you remove it. Control-click a device name to remove it.
Turn Bluetooth on or off. Click the Control Center icon in the menu bar, click the Bluetooth icon
, then click the control to turn Bluetooth on or off. Your iMac comes with Bluetooth turned on.
Tip: If you donโt see the Bluetooth icon in the menu bar, you can add it. Click the Bluetooth icon
in Control Center, click Bluetooth Preferences, then select โShow Bluetooth in menu bar.โ
